This is like, the most uninteresting gift ever, but IMO it's the most useful thing you can ever have: http://www.tripplite.com/products/product.cfm?productID=1949 It's a 24-outlet power strip. I got one before my last year of college, and it was a GREAT investment. Dorm rooms never have enough power outlets, and you end up with one power strip plugged into another, into another, and the whole thing is a mess. The outlets are always in the worst possible place, and they are hard to reach. With this, you get like a whole wall of outlets, and the extension cord is really long, so you can put it almost anywhere. This thing is crazy-insane useful. I got one for my brother for graduation and he loves his. I still use mine.
